In Jamaica, stealing is a criminal offense that can lead to severe consequences, including arrest and imprisonment. The legal system takes theft seriously, and penalties can vary depending on the value of the stolen items and the circumstances of the crime. Convictions can result in significant fines and prison sentences, reflecting the country's efforts to maintain Law and Order. Additionally, theft can lead to social stigma and loss of trust within the community.
